Original post by dearzo
Hi guys. Are there any current medic undergrads out there who can tell me what to read up on/what text books to buy for my first year. Secured a place at med for Bart's 5 year MBBS but currently on my gap year so wanted to prep myself a little bit so next year doesn't become too much of a shocker. Thanks! :biggrin:


Barts first year here, I bought 2 of the 3 recommended textbooks. I haven't had the real need to use any of them and most of the time you don't. Maybe the exception is when you do PBL writeups but then you need many sources anyway so you can just go to the library and use the books there.


TL;DR don't buy textbooks before you come, if you wanted you have more than enough time after you enrol. They're probably cheaper from QM bookstore anyway.
